1.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is a coefficient in an algebraic expression?
Back
A coefficient is a numerical factor that multiplies a variable in an algebraic expression.

3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is a constant in an algebraic expression?
Back
A constant is a fixed value that does not change, such as -7 in the expression x - 7.

6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
How do you identify the coefficient in an expression like -9 + -5x?
Back
The coefficient is the number that is multiplied by the variable, which is -5 in this case.
Tags
CCSS.6.EE.A.2B
7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the difference between a variable and a constant?
Back
A variable can change and represent different values, while a constant remains the same.
